2008 Skoda Fabia vs. 2010 Toyota Hilux

To start off, 2010 Toyota Hilux is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 Skoda Fabia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 Skoda Fabia would be higher. At 2,493 cc (4 cylinders), 2010 Toyota Hilux is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Skoda Fabia (105 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 4 more horse power than 2010 Toyota Hilux. (101 HP @ 3600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Skoda Fabia should accelerate faster than 2010 Toyota Hilux.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Toyota Hilux weights approximately 285 kg more than 2008 Skoda Fabia.

Because 2010 Toyota Hilux is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2010 Toyota Hilux.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Skoda Fabia,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Skoda Fabia (240 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 40 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Toyota Hilux. (200 Nm @ 1400 RPM). This means 2008 Skoda Fabia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Toyota Hilux.
